LonGi 375W Solar Panel Overview:
The LonGi 375W Solar Panel (LR6-72HBD, 360-385 Watt) utilizes advanced bifacial PERC technology with half-cut cells, delivering high efficiency and performance. With a maximum power output of 375W and module efficiency of up to 19.1%, this panel is ideal for large-scale utility and commercial solar projects. Its bifacial design enables up to 25% additional energy harvesting from the rear side, making it highly effective for installations with reflective surfaces. Built with robust materials, the panel can withstand harsh environmental conditions, including front-side static loads of 5400Pa and rear-side static loads of 2400Pa.
LonGi 375W Solar Panel Key Features:
-
Bifacial Technology: Harvests additional energy from the rear side, with up to 25% more power output.
-
High Efficiency: Module conversion efficiency up to 19.1%, enhancing energy production.
-
Low Power Degradation: Annual power degradation of 0.45%, ensuring more than 84.95% power output after 30 years.
-
Durable Design: Capable of withstanding 5400Pa front-side static loads and 2400Pa rear-side static loads, suitable for challenging environments.
-
PID Resistance: Improved resistance to Potential Induced Degradation ensures long-term reliability.
-
Reduced Hot Spot Risk: Optimized electrical design minimizes the risk of hot spots.

Warranty:
-
10-year product warranty for materials and workmanship.
-
30-year linear power warranty with an annual degradation rate of 0.45%, ensuring over 84.95% power output at the end of 30 years.
